2011-08-26 19 views
23

द्वारा FQL के साथ सभी टिप्पणियां पुनर्प्राप्त करें हम फेसबुक साइट टिप्पणी प्लगइन का उपयोग हमारी साइट पर टिप्पणियों के लिए करते हैं।आवेदन आईडी

उन मॉडरेट करने के लिए, हम इस उपकरण का उपयोग: https://developers.facebook.com/tools/comments

हालांकि, हम उन टिप्पणियों को मॉडरेट करना हमारे अपने उपकरण का निर्माण, और हमारे मौजूदा सॉफ्टवेयर को एकीकृत करने के लिए चाहते हैं।

मुझे ऐसा करने का एक उचित तरीका नहीं मिल रहा है। एक ही रास्ता मैं अब पता चला अनुसंधान के घंटे के बाद इस FQL क्वेरी है:

select post_fbid, fromid, object_id, text, time from comment where object_id in (select comments_fbid from link_stat where url ='URL_HERE') 

ऐसा इसलिए है क्योंकि हम अलग अलग यूआरएल के हजारों है और यदि कोई हो तो हर बार देखने के लिए मैं उनमें से प्रत्येक को क्वेरी नहीं कर सकते काम नहीं करता है नई टिप्पणियां

मैं सिर्फ हमारे APP_ID, डोमेन या कि

मैं यह कैसे कर सकते की तरह कुछ में प्रवेश करके सभी (नया) टिप्पणियां प्राप्त करने के लिए कोई तरीका होना चाहिए? अपने आवेदन के द्वारा प्रयोग किया सभी टिप्पणियों xids के लिए

+0

दुर्भाग्यवश, इस मुद्दे को लगभग एक दिन तक शोध करने के बाद, मैंने पाया कि यह केवल तभी संभव है जब आपके पास उप-पृष्ठों का एक निश्चित सेट है जिसे आप टिप्पणियां प्राप्त करना चाहते हैं। मैंने यहां पोस्ट किया गया उत्तर देखें: http://stackoverflow.com/a/10412716/280503 – gardenofwine

उत्तर

0

इस कोड प्रश्नों:

https://graph.facebook.com/fql?q=SELECT fromid, text, id, time, username, xid, object_id FROM comment WHERE xid IN (SELECT xid FROM comments_info WHERE app_id = {0}) ORDER BY time desc&access_token={1}&format=json 
+4

नई टिप्पणियों के लिए यह काम नहीं करता है। एफबी: 'नोट: इस तालिका में लीगेसी एफबी: टिप्पणियों द्वारा उपयोग किए गए XIDs में app_id का मैपिंग शामिल है। इसमें वर्तमान टिप्पणियां प्लगइन के लिए कोई नक्शा नहीं है, जो XIDs.' [link] (https://developers.facebook.com/docs/reference/fql/comments_info/) – neworld

+1

क्षमा नहीं करता है, जो मदद नहीं कर सकता आप – Oleg

2

मैं अपने आवेदन के लिए सभी उपयोगकर्ता पदों हथियाने एक ही बात कर रही है पर विचार कर रहा हूँ। मुझे लगता है कि यह एक समान काम है।

दिए गए उपयोगकर्ता के लिए, मैं ऐप पोस्ट की तलाश में फ़ीड और घर के माध्यम से स्क्रॉल करूंगा। आपके लिए, आप जायेंगे:

`home?fields=comments` 
`feed?fields=comments` 

और अपने एप्लिकेशन से मेल खाने के लिए "टाइप" और "आईडी" की जांच करें।

+1

अन्ना जब आप किसी ऑब्जेक्ट से टिप्पणियां फ़ील्ड करते हैं तो यह टिप्पणियों और पसंदों का नमूना है, बिलकुल नहीं। आपको कनेक्शन से पूछना होगा। /post_id/टिप्पणियां –